mysql查询2进制数据的方法及注意事项

更新时间:02-10 教程 由 思君 分享

MySQL是一种常用的关系型数据库管理系统,支持存储二进制数据。本文将介绍如何在MySQL中查询二进制数据,并提供一些注意事项。

1. 使用HEX函数查询二进制数据

ytablen的十六进制表示:

nytable;

2. 使用UNHEX函数将十六进制数据转换为二进制数据

ytablen的二进制表示:

nytable;

3. 注意事项

在查询二进制数据时,需要注意以下几点:

- 如果二进制数据包含控制字符或非ASCII字符,则可能会出现意外结果。在这种情况下,可以考虑使用BASE64编码来存储和查询二进制数据。

- 如果使用HEX函数查询二进制数据,则结果将始终是一个字符串。在使用结果时,需要注意将其转换为适当的类型。

- 如果使用UNHEX函数将十六进制数据转换为二进制数据,则需要确保十六进制数据的格式正确。如果格式不正确,则可能会出现意外结果。

本文介绍了如何在MySQL中查询二进制数据,以及需要注意的一些事项。使用HEX和UNHEX函数可以方便地进行二进制数据的转换和查询。在使用时,需要注意数据的格式和编码方式,以避免出现意外结果。

声明:关于《mysql查询2进制数据的方法及注意事项》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2267619.html